Print

基于单片机的路面平整度测试仪的研究

论文摘要

随着我国铁路的大面积提速和重载列车数量的不断增多,为确保铁路运输安全并提高列车运行的平稳性和舒适性,研制一种携带方便、价格低廉、车载式的可进行实时动态监测和定位的路轨平整度测试装置,及时查找出导致列车振动的故障点,具有较大的实用价值和社会效益。本文研发了由UPS电源、YZ-6型磁电式速度传感器、C8051F020单片机、HOLUX M-89 GPS接收模组以及笔记本电脑五个模块组成的路轨平整度测试装置,实现了对因路面不平引起振动的实时检测和故障点超限报警,并通过传感器和GPS联动,经卫星系统,在电子地图上对故障点进行定位。除了系统硬件结构的设计外,通过对C8051F020单片机寄存器、串口以及端口等片内功能部件的研究,结合使用单片机片内的模数转换器将外界的模拟信号转换成数字信号、将振动信号的电压值在LCD上显示并通过二极管报警。利用单片机的C语言完成了单片机的初始化、模数转换、显示以及报警程序的设计,并通过仿真软件Keil uVision3对程序进行了调试。采用VB的MSComm控件实现了计算机与单片机以及计算机与GPS之间的串口通信,完成了测振系统报警界面的设计。本文的研究内容为高速铁路和动车急需的路轨平整度测试设备的国产化提供了一个有参考价值的研究方法。

论文目录

  • 摘要
  • Abstract
  • 第1章 绪论
  • 1.1 课题研究的背景及意义
  • 1.2 国内外研究现状
  • 1.2.1 传感器研究现状
  • 1.2.2 振动测试仪研究现状
  • 1.3 本课题研究的主要内容
  • 第2章 测振系统的硬件设计
  • 2.1 系统实现的功能
  • 2.2 测振系统组成
  • 2.2.1 传感器模块
  • 2.2.2 单片机模块
  • 2.3 GPS 模块
  • 2.4 本章小结
  • 第3章 测振系统软件设计
  • 3.1 测振系统软件结构设计
  • 3.2 单片机系统时钟初始化
  • 3.3 串口UART0 初始化
  • 3.4 端口I/O 初始化
  • 3.5 LCD 初始化
  • 3.6 单片机的单通道数据采集
  • 3.7 本章小结
  • 第4章 串口通信显示界面的设计与实现
  • 4.1 利用VB 对GPS 和单片机数据的提取和处理
  • 4.1.1 VB 对GPS 数据的提取和处理
  • 4.1.2 VB 对单片机数据的提取和处理
  • 4.2 串口通信界面的设计
  • 4.2.1 MSComm 控件的基本属性及使用
  • 4.2.2 串口通信窗体的设计
  • 4.3 本章小结
  • 第5章 系统软件的调试以及实验结果的分析
  • 5.1 Keil uVision3 软件介绍
  • 5.2 现场测量及其数据分析
  • 5.2.1 测振仪测量结果
  • 5.2.2 电子地图测量结果
  • 5.3 测试结果
  • 结论
  • 参考文献
  • 攻读硕士学位期间发表的学术论文
  • 致谢
  • 相关论文文献

    本文来源: https://www.lw50.cn/article/e128077f6cd6ad32637572d3.html